Microchip Technology's 93LC56XT-I/SN
The 93LC56XT-I/SN is a high-quality EEPROM (Electrically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ory) chip produced by Microchip Technology, a leading provider of microcontroller, mixed-signal, analog, and Flash-IP solutions. This device is part of Microchip's extensive serial EEPROM product line and offers a reliable storage solution for various applications that require low-power and small-footprint non-volatile memory.
The 93LC56XT-I/SN is designed with a standard serial interface, which enables easy integration into a wide range of electronic systems. The device operates over a voltage range of 2.5V to 5.5V, making it suitable for both 3.3V and 5V systems. It features a 2K-bit memory size and is organized as either 128 x 16-bit or 256 x 8-bit, depending on the mode selected, providing flexibility for different data storage requirements.
This EEPROM comes in a compact 8-pin SOIC (Small Outline Integrated Circuit) package, which is ideal for space-constrained applications. The 93LC56XT-I/SN is designed with Microchip's advanced technology, ensuring high reliability and low power consumption. The device supports a wide temperature range of -40°C to +85°C, making it robust enough for use in industrial and automotive environments.
Key features of the 93LC56XT-I/SN include:
- Self-timed erase and write cycles with auto-erase
- Write protection mechanisms to prevent accidental data corruption
- Sequential read function for efficient data retrieval
- More than 1 million erase/write cycles endurance
- Data retention of over 200 years
- Low-power operation and standby mode for energy-saving applications
